Residential Furnace Repair in Harrisburg
Harrisburg has grown quickly, and most of that growth is newer construction with high-efficiency condensing furnaces. Those systems are efficient and quiet, but they fail differently than older equipment: pressure switch faults, plugged condensate traps, and control board errors instead of simple pilot problems.

What Makes Harrisburg Homes Different
Because a large share of Harrisburg houses are under 20 years old, many repairs come down to a single component rather than a failing system, which usually means a repair is clearly the better financial choice.
Open exposure south of Sioux Falls means blowing snow and wind chill regularly hit sidewall vent terminations, which is one of the most common winter lockout causes we see here.
Furnace Problems We See Most in Harrisburg
- Condensing furnaces shutting down after drifting snow blocks the PVC intake or exhaust termination.
- Pressure switch lockouts caused by water standing in the condensate trap or drain line.
- Smart thermostats installed without a C-wire, dropping power and stopping heat calls intermittently.
- Ignition lockouts after three failed light-off attempts, requiring a sensor cleaning or ignitor replacement.
- Airflow complaints in two-story homes where upstairs bedrooms never reach thermostat setpoint.

Do you work on older furnaces in Harrisburg homes?+
We repair older residential gas and electric furnaces whenever parts are still available and the system can run safely. If a heat exchanger is cracked or a repair no longer makes financial sense, we say so plainly and explain the repair-versus-replace math instead of pushing equipment.
